Abstract
Apparatus and method for handling system information in mobile telecommunications system user equipment, wherein updates are applied in a defined order. In particular, in 3G UMTS systems, when System Information Block (SIB) SIB 11 and SIB 12 are received with information elements relating to cell information list (e.g. 'intra-frequency cell info list', 'inter-frequency cell info list' and “Inter-RAT cell info list”) then the system information associated with the system information block information element in SIB 11 is applied before the system information associated with the system information block information element in SIB 12.
